POSITION SUMMARYThe Service Supervisor will manage and plan daily job scheduling, providing excellent service to area customer base. The successful candidate will manage and motivate team of Service Technicians including operations, planning, budget setting, and cost control and profit maximization. Candidate, preferably has a proven track record in managing and developing people, a demonstrated ability to establish and accomplish goals and priorities, and the ability to recognize, develop, and utilize resources and achieve outcomes that consistently exceed customers' expectation
Job Planning.
Manage, motivate and lead daily work activities of Shop Service Technicians and provide supervision and managerial support.
Ensure professionalism and a high customer service standard.
Expedite service orders and calls, if necessary.
Sell repairs and follow up work.
Track and follow up on leads brought in by field operatives (technicians and inspectors).
Develop quotes in a timely manner.
Schedule preventive maintenance and repair activities on equipment.
Resolve customer issues and complaints.
Complete, process and route appropriate paperwork.
Provide a high level of communication with both Customer and Office.
Perform service work to assist with overflow and emergencies, as needed.
Source difficult to find parts.
Coordinate the procurement of supplies, materials, equipment, and subcontract labor for jobs.
Monitor and coordinate the maintenance of company equipment and assets to ensure they are in proper condition and good working order.
Inspect overhead crane and hoist and conduct spot inspections and audits of the Service Technicians’ equipment and vehicles and record the results.
Enter data into SAP database as necessary and utilize MS Office applications
Responsible for all miscellaneous activities within the branch such as shipping/receiving, shop cleanliness, equipment/building maintenance, answering phones
